CHORE Program

We help improve living conditions for low income elderly or disabled
homeowners who have applied for the program with the Southfield city government.  Bushes are trimmed, weeds are pulled, beds are mulched, and flowers are planted to spiff up the front yard.  This allows residents to feel that they are not letting the neighborhood down and stay longer in their homes.

Park Trail Program

We have helped maintain and provide mapping services
for walking trails in the City's parks.

Community Pride

The Club awards "Fine Place Awards" to outstanding places in Southfield.
We also cosponsor and help judge the "Community
Pride Awards" program.

Community Involvement

In 2014 the Club assisted Rebuilding Together Oakland County
on a neighborhood revitalization
project in the John Grace Neighborhood on May 3.
